Full Time Description & Requirements Our firm provides assurance services that go beyond the compliance function. Alongside the rest of our team, you will bring credibility to our client’s financial picture, communicate information objectively and clearly, and provide insight to help clients improve their businesses.

If relationships are important to you, and you identify with the People First culture at Forvis Mazars, we would like to hear from you!
How you will contribute:
Performing detailed audit procedures over various income statement and balance sheet accounts
Proactively interacting with key client management to demonstrate your ability to recognize problems and propose sensible solutions
Using technology tools proficiently in regular assignments and demonstrating a commitment to improving work processes by using technology
Maintaining the appropriate balance between client needs and Forvis Mazars’ risk
Managing assigned workload between yourself and Forvis Mazars employees
Meeting assigned deadlines or budgets and providing advanced notification of any variances
Traveling to serve clients as necessary
Completing required Continued Professional Education
We are looking for people who have

Forward Vision and:

An ability to prioritize and work independently in a fast-paced environment to reach clear-set goals
Communication skills to effectively relate to people of diverse backgrounds and experience levels, both verbally and in writing
Knowledge of current audit and accounting concepts
Ability to maintain professional client relationships
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ite
A desire to provide mentorship and training to other professionals

Minimum Qualifications:

Bachelor’s degree in accounting or a related field
At least 2 years of relevant audit experience
CPA license or have secured the educational requirements to satisfy the 150-credit hour requirement necessary to obtain a CPA license.
